This fall, the Federal Office for Migration decided to house 140 asylum seekers from North Africa in a military facility near Bettwil, Aargau. This decision caused a stir throughout the canton of Aargau. Both the Federal Office for Migration and the Cantonal Council of Aargau were harshly criticized. However, the controversial role of the Federal Ministry of Defense (DDPS) was ignored. The reason: In March 2011, an emergency meeting took place between the Migration Office and the DDPS. The DDPS offered to house asylum seekers in military facilities. Little has happened since then. Therefore, I investigated why the DDPS does not release military facilities and why the evaluation of the facilities takes so long.
